## Essential Units for Certified Specialist Programme in Genomics and Behavioral Disorders **Module 1: Foundations of Genomics** * • **Gene Expression** - Understanding how genes are expressed and regulated. * • **Genetic Variation** - Exploring the different types of genetic variations and their impact on disease. * • **Genomics Tools and Technologies** - Learning about the latest tools and technologies used in genomics research. **Module 2: Genetic Basis of Psychiatric Disorders** * • **Genetics of Psychiatric Disorders** - Delving into the genetic underpinnings of mental health conditions. * • **Genetic Risk Factors** - Identifying genetic variants associated with psychiatric disorders. * • **Genetic Testing in Psychiatry** - Understanding the role of genetic testing in diagnosis and treatment. **Module 3: Neurobiology of Behavior** * • **Neurotransmitters and Brain Chemistry** - Exploring the role of neurotransmitters in behavior and mental processes. * • **Behavioral Genetics** - Investigating the genetic basis of behavioral traits and disorders. * • **Neuroimaging Techniques** - Learning about the latest neuroimaging methods used in behavioral research. **Module 4: Genetic Research Methods** * • **Experimental Design** - Developing and implementing research protocols for studying genetic disorders. * • **Next-Generation Sequencing** - Understanding and applying next-generation sequencing technologies. * • **Bioinformatics** - Using bioinformatics tools for data analysis and interpretation. **Module 5: Ethical and Social Considerations in Genomics and Behavioral Disorders** * • **Informed Consent** - Ensuring ethical and informed consent from participants in genetic research. * • **Data Privacy and Security** - Understanding and adhering to data privacy regulations. * • **The Public's Role in Genomics** - Engaging the public in understanding and addressing genetic disorders. **Module 6: Advanced Topics in Genomics and Behavioral Disorders** * • **Epigenetics** - Exploring the role of epigenetics in gene expression and disease. * • **Systems Biology** - Understanding complex biological systems and their interactions. * • **Biomarker Discovery** - Identifying genetic and biological markers for disease diagnosis and prognosis.
